    Alan Roger Davies (/ ˈ d eɪ v ɪ s /; [1] born 6 March 1966) [2] is an English stand-up comedian, writer, actor and TV presenter. He is best known for his portrayal of the title role in the BBC mystery drama series Jonathan Creek (1997–2016) and as the only permanent panellist on the BBC panel show QI since its premiere in 2003, outlasting ...
